Availability of Outpatient Telemental Health Services in the United States at the Outset of the COVID-19 Pandemic

At the onset of the COVID-19 pandemic, fewer than half of outpatient mental health treatment facilities were providing telehealth services. Our results suggest that additional policies to promote telehealth may be warranted to increase availability over the course of the COVID-19 pandemic.
